Quote, we concluded that the Secretary sent sensitive, non-public, operational information that he determined did not require classification over the signal chat on his personal cell phone. The secretary is the head original classification authority in the DOD based on Executive Order 13526 and DOD manual 5200.45 and holds the authority to determine the required classification level of all DOD information he communicates. However, because the Secretary indicated that he used the Signal application on his personal cell phone to send non-public DOD information, we concluded that the Secretary's actions did not comply with DOD instruction 8170.01, which prohibits using a personal device for official business and using non-approved commercially available messaging applications to send non-public DOD information.
